The EPC uses an inverse control strategy to make it fail-safe. In other words, maximum electrical signal will mean minimum line pressure. That way, a complete electrical failure will result in maximum line pressure. Same fail-safe strategy like on the older C6; lose vacuum signal, and the transmission thinks its always at WOT. This is in contrast to the mechanical AOD in the half-ton trucks that will go to minimum line pressure if the throttle valve cable ever snaps.

As for both solenoids being off...ok, bear with me.

That is where you should produce 4th gear.
2nd gear is hydraulically forced by the shift linkage changing position, regardless of what the solenoids are commanding. And even though having both shift solenoids being off is still a valid shift command, it still gets ignored.

This is just the way ford engineered it back in the day. In reality, the E4OD is the evolutionary link between mechanical and electronic automatics, so the mechanical valve body still has a lot of direct control over what happens, and when. I even tested this on mine unintentionally years back when I incorrectly wired up my MLPS. Even when the controller was trying to electronically command 3rd gear (verified via live monitoring), the transmission would stay in 2nd so long as I had the shifter there.
